This Year's Model Updates:

Changes are minimal for the XC90's second year on the market. All models get wheel and tire upgrades -- 2.5Ts will wear 225/70R17 rubber and T6s will wear 235/65R17 rubber, but both get the same 17-inch "Neptune" wheels. Ice White is a new exterior color choice. Stand-alone options now include a wood steering wheel, aluminum dash inlays and a leather shift knob.

Pros:
  • Safe as a bank vault, plush ride, feels smaller than it is, high-quality interior materials, ample cargo room.
Cons:
  • Turbocharged T6 engine not well suited to SUV duty, third-row seating takes up too much second-row space.

  • Transmission exploded after one month - 2004 Volvo XC90
    By -

    Do not buy this year xc90 under ANY circumstances. Had it one and a half months, transmission exploded. Car has low miles (45,000) and I bought the aftermarket warranty. They will not cover the loss due to a clip failure in the transmission, which fails due to a too short lube tube from the pan. Thumbs way down.

  • Huge Transmission Problems - 2004 Volvo XC90
    By -

    We loved our 2004 T6 until yesterday when we had to be towed from Lake Tahoe to a Sacramento Volvo Dealer ( 109 miles ). Two different dealers told me this model has a huge transmission problem. There is talk of a law suit on the discussion board as so many owners have had problems. To be fair, some of the owners got full replacement including trnsmission, lines and radiator (around $7000 n). Well see how it goes ...
